JA Group of Florida Launches Program to Provide Financial Relief for Condo Owners!

JA Group of Florida has announced a groundbreaking program to provide financial relief to condominium owners facing skyrocketing costs due to increased building safety and reserve funding regulations. This initiative aims to help affected owners remain in their homes while addressing the critical safety measures mandated by recent legislation.

Following the tragic 2021 collapse of the Champlain Towers South condominium in Surfside, Florida, state lawmakers introduced stringent safety and financial reserve requirements for older condo buildings. While designed to prevent future catastrophes, these regulations have created significant financial challenges for condo owners, particularly those in older properties.

The program introduced by JA Group of Florida will provide financing options to include costs for necessary inspections, structural repairs, assessments, and mandated reserve funding. The program is designed to provide financial assistance to homeowners, ensuring they can comply with new safety measures and reserve requirements without being displaced.
